IMovie Recognizing iPhone 4 as Camera

I've discovered that you can view iPhone 4 video clips in iMovie by clicking on the iPhoto Video link - but is there a way to get iMovie to recognize the iPhone +as a camera+ so you could import directly an skip the iPhoto step? I would prefer NOT to have most of my video clips cluttering up my iPhoto library.

This is a problem which is not restricted to just the iPhone 4 but seems to apply to many if not all camera phones and point and shoots. Dedicated camcorders are recognized as camcorders and likely to contain video so best to open in iMovie directly. iMovie also recognizes high end still cameras that also shoot HD such as my Panasonic GH1 and open it directly in iMovie.
Perhaps Apple in its wisdom decided that cheaper cameras are likely used by people who are less likely to edit video and might be annoyed or confused by the camera opening in iMovie but I think it more likely that the cause lies in the way camcorders and some high end cameras identify themselves with some telling the computer it is still camera, some saying they are a camcorder and some saying that they are both.
In the case of the iPhone4 Apple makes both the iPhone and iMovie so if it is possible for them to do it they could potentially fix this. I would suggest writing a product feedback asking for the fix here:

  • Vista not recognizing IPhone as camera....

    Well, my IPhone and Vista worked fine a couple days ago but now, Windows doesn't recognize IPhone as a camera, so i can't get my pictures off it as easily.
    http://sleekupload.com/uploads/untitled_83.jpg
    The link above is Vista trying to install drivers but failing. It was working fine before but it just...stopped.

    First connect open iTunes and connect your iPhone to your computer then follow the steps below
    1. Hold down the Windows Key and press R.
    2. Type devmgmt.msc and click OK.
    3. Right-click Apple Mobile Device listed under Other Devices and then select Properties.
    4. Select Browse…
    5. Point it to C:\Program Files\Common Files\Apple\Mobile Device Support\drivers and click OK.
    6. Disconnect your iPhone close iTunes then reconnect your iPhone and try again
    The install should finish and your iPhone should now be all good.
    If this does not work
    Quit iTunes if it is open
    From the Start menu select the Control panel
    In Windows XP, choose Add or Remove Programs, then click Remove. Also remove any other items with the word “iTunes” in their names. Also remove any iPod-related entries.
    Restart your PC.
    Delete the iTunes program itself, if it still exists after the steps you’ve already taken (by default it’s located in the “Program Files” folder)
    Again restart your PC.
    Download the latest version of iTunes for Windows and install it.

  • Cannot Import Video made with iMovie for iPhone/iPod Touch

    I edited a video on my iPod touch using Apple's iMovie. The resulting .MOV file that iMovie creates will not import into iPhoto '11. While iMovie recognises the file just fine, iPhoto believes it is an unsupported file type. It's a .MOV for goodness sakes created with Apple's own hardware and program! Very strange. Just wondering if anyone else has had a similar experience.

    Hey there. In answer to your question, all other clips that appear in my camera roll are easily seen by iPhoto. It is only those movies that I have created with iMovie for iPhone that iPhoto does not recognize. It's really strange, considering the fact that it's just a .MOV file. As a result, I've had to download a program called 'DiskAid' that allows me to transfer the .MOV file directly to my computer from the iPod Touch.
    In answer to your question regarding whether or not iMovie for iPhone was worth downloading, I would have to say yes (assuming of course the import-to-iPhoto problem gets fixed). It's not a perfect program. My biggest complaint is that you have to import clips ONE at a time. There's no 'import all' option. This is really time consuming as you have to cycle through all the videos on your iPod or iPhone and manually tap each one and repeat. My dad likes to take a lot of 1-minute videos that then have to get spliced together and that can be really tedious with how this iMovie is currently set up. However, if you regularly think to add your clips to an existing project as you go along, things should be fine. It could do with a few more features and faster rendering times, but on the whole, it's a decent program. I have a feeling, though, that it was designed more for the YouTube generation who want to upload a five-minute video instead of people like my father and I who like to edit an hour or so and then eventually burn to a DVD. iMovie for the Mac still CERTAINLY has it's place.
